There's a reason why collagen - the protein found naturally in the skin - is one of the most popular skincare ingredients in the beauty lexicon today. From the best collagen-packed creams to those that are brimming with ingredients that help boost collagen production, discover the best in class for 2025, below. While the collagen molecule itself is usually considered too large to penetrate the skin, what these formulas can do, however, is act as a humectant, enriching the layers of the skin with hydration and adding a visible plumping effect. Fortunately, collagen creams can work to firm and rejuvenate skin if (and only if) topical collagen is joined by ingredients that have been scientifically proven to enhance collagen production, as Dr. Desai mentioned earlier. If you want your collagen cream to boost collagen production, smooth fine lines, and amplify the elasticity of your skin, topical collagen, itself, cannot do so, according to board-certified dermatologist Dendy Engelman, MD.
